Essential Storage and Handling Guidelines

Proper storage and handling form the foundation of food safety and quality preservation with frozen prepared meals. Understanding these principles ensures you maintain the integrity of your meals from delivery to consumption.

Freezer Storage Best Practices

When storing frozen prepared meals for extended periods, maintain your freezer at 0°F (-18°C) or below. Position meals away from the freezer door where temperature fluctuations are most common. Stack meals flat to maximize space efficiency and ensure even freezing throughout the package. Always check that packaging remains intact without tears or punctures that could lead to freezer burn.

To freeze meals for longer preservation beyond their refrigerated shelf life, ensure they're properly sealed and dated. While frozen meals can technically remain safe indefinitely at proper temperatures, quality begins to decline after several months. Most frozen prepared meals maintain optimal taste and texture for three to six months when stored correctly.

Storage should avoid sun exposure entirely, as even indirect sunlight through windows can cause surface warming that compromises the frozen state. This is particularly important if you have a chest freezer in a garage or utility room with windows. Temperature consistency is more important than absolute cold—fluctuating temperatures create ice crystals that damage food structure.

Refrigerated Storage Protocols

If you're planning to consume meals within the next few days, refrigerated storage at 35-40°F (2-4°C) is appropriate. This eliminates the need for defrosting and can actually improve heating evenness since you're starting from a less extreme temperature. However, once thawed, most frozen prepared meals should be consumed within 3-4 days maximum.

Never leave frozen meals at room temperature to thaw, as this creates dangerous conditions where bacterial growth can occur in outer portions while the center remains frozen. The refrigerator thawing method is always safest, requiring 24 hours for most standard-sized meals.

Open Package Storage Time

Once you've opened a frozen meal package, consumption timing becomes critical. If you've heated only a portion of a multi-serving meal, transfer any unused portions to airtight containers immediately. Refrigerate within two hours of opening (one hour if room temperature exceeds 90°F) and consume within 3-4 days. Never refreeze previously frozen meals that have been fully thawed, as this significantly compromises both safety and quality.

For meals you've partially consumed after heating, the single-reheat warning becomes especially important. These meals were designed for one heating cycle, and subsequent reheating can create uneven temperatures that may not eliminate bacteria while simultaneously overcooking and drying out the food.

Defrosting and Reheating Methods: Comprehensive Guide

The method you choose for defrosting and reheating dramatically impacts the final texture, flavor, and safety of your frozen prepared meal. Each approach offers distinct advantages depending on your time constraints and texture preferences.

Microwave Defrosting and Heating

Microwave reheating remains the most common method due to its speed and the fact that most frozen meal packaging is specifically designed as microwave-safe packaging. To achieve optimal results, remove any components that aren't microwave-safe (metal clips, foil lids) and follow the appliance-specific heating guidance provided on the package.

For defrosting in the microwave, use the defrost setting (typically 30% power) for 2-3 minutes for standard 10-12 ounce meals. This gentle warming prevents the edges from cooking while the center remains frozen. After defrosting, increase to full power and heat in 90-second intervals, stirring or rotating between intervals to ensure even heating throughout.

The key to avoiding overheating is monitoring closely during the final minute. Overheating causes several problems: proteins become rubbery, vegetables turn mushy, sauces separate, and nutritional value degrades. The ideal internal temperature for reheated meals is 165°F (74°C)—hot enough for food safety but not so hot that it damages food structure.

To avoid soggy texture when microwaving, leave one corner of the film cover slightly vented to allow steam to escape. Trapped steam creates condensation that drips back onto the food, making crispy components soggy and diluting sauces. Some packages include pre-cut vent holes for this purpose.

Air Fryer Heating Method

Air fryer preparation has revolutionized frozen meal reheating by restoring the crispy, caramelized textures that microwaving cannot achieve. This method is particularly effective for meals featuring breaded proteins, roasted vegetables, or grain components that benefit from a slight crisp.

To reheat frozen meals in an air fryer, first transfer the meal from its original packaging to an air fryer-safe container or directly into the air fryer basket if the components allow. Preheat your air fryer to 350°F (175°C). For frozen meals, heat for 12-15 minutes, shaking or stirring halfway through. For refrigerated (pre-thawed) meals, reduce time to 8-10 minutes.

The air fryer method requires slightly more attention to prevent drying. Lightly spray or brush proteins with a small amount of oil before heating to maintain moisture while achieving surface crispness. For meals with sauces, consider heating the sauce components separately in a microwave-safe container and adding them after air frying the solid components.

This heating method preference works exceptionally well for meals featuring chicken breast, fish fillets, roasted vegetables, and grain bowls. It's less ideal for meals with delicate sauces or ingredients that benefit from steaming rather than dry heat.

Thawing Instructions by Product Type

Different meal types require adapted thawing approaches based on their composition and intended final texture.

Protein-heavy meals (chicken, beef, fish) benefit from overnight refrigerator thawing followed by shorter, more controlled reheating. This prevents the common problem of overcooked edges and cold centers that occurs when heating from fully frozen.

Vegetable-forward meals can often be heated directly from frozen, as vegetables contain high water content that facilitates even heating. However, delicate vegetables like leafy greens or zucchini may become mushy if heated too aggressively.

Grain-based meals (rice bowls, pasta dishes, quinoa meals) should be stirred thoroughly halfway through heating regardless of method. Grains tend to heat unevenly, creating hot spots and cold spots within the same container.

Sauce-heavy meals require the most careful attention. Defrost these partially before final heating, and stir thoroughly multiple times during the heating process. Sauces can separate if heated too quickly or reach boiling temperatures.

Defining Reheating Times by Meal Size

Standard single-serving meals (8-12 ounces) typically require 3-4 minutes in the microwave from refrigerated or 5-7 minutes from frozen. Larger meals (14-16 ounces) need 5-6 minutes refrigerated or 8-10 minutes frozen. Always use these as starting points and adjust based on your specific microwave wattage—lower wattage units require longer heating times.

For air fryer heating, meal size affects heating time less dramatically due to the circulating hot air. However, increase time by 2-3 minutes for larger portions and ensure you're not overcrowding the basket, which restricts air circulation and creates uneven heating.

Dietary Customization and Considerations

Modern frozen prepared meals cater to an increasingly diverse range of dietary needs and preferences, with clear labeling and certifications that simplify meal selection for those with restrictions or specific nutritional goals.

Vegan and Vegetarian Options

Vegan frozen meals contain no animal products whatsoever—no meat, dairy, eggs, or honey. These meals typically feature plant-based proteins like legumes, tofu, tempeh, or newer plant-based meat alternatives. They provide complete nutrition through strategic ingredient combinations that deliver all essential amino acids.

Vegetarian meals may include dairy products and eggs but exclude meat, poultry, and fish. These meals often feature cheese-based sauces, egg-containing pasta, or dairy-based creamy elements that provide richness and protein.

When selecting vegan or vegetarian frozen meals, pay particular attention to protein content per meal. Plant-based proteins may require larger portion sizes to match the protein density of animal-based meals. Look for meals providing at least 15-20g of protein to ensure adequate satiety and muscle maintenance.

Gluten-Free Selections

Gluten-free frozen meals eliminate wheat, barley, rye, and any ingredients derived from these grains. This is essential for those with celiac disease or non-celiac gluten sensitivity. Modern gluten-free meals have evolved far beyond simple "grain-free" options, now featuring gluten-free pasta, bread alternatives, and grain substitutes that closely mimic traditional textures.

When choosing gluten-free options, verify that the packaging includes clear allergen and cross-contact information. Even naturally gluten-free ingredients can be contaminated during processing if manufactured in facilities that also process wheat products. Look for dedicated gluten-free facility certifications for the highest safety level.

Dairy-Free Products

Dairy-free frozen meals exclude all milk-based ingredients including milk, cheese, butter, cream, and yogurt. These meals use alternative ingredients like coconut milk, cashew cream, nutritional yeast, or plant-based cheese alternatives to create rich, satisfying flavors without dairy.

This designation is crucial for those with lactose intolerance or milk protein allergies. Note that "dairy-free" is not automatically vegan, as some dairy-free meals may still contain eggs or meat products.

Nut-Free Options

Nut-free meals contain no tree nuts (almonds, cashews, walnuts, pecans, etc.) or peanuts. This is critical for those with severe nut allergies, which can be life-threatening. When selecting nut-free meals, look for clear allergen statements and cross-contact warnings.

Be particularly cautious with Asian-inspired meals, which traditionally use peanut-based sauces, and with meals featuring "creamy" sauces that might use cashew cream as a dairy alternative. Always verify the ingredient list even if the meal appears nut-free based on the description.

Low Sodium Varieties

Low-sodium frozen meals typically contain 600mg of sodium or less per serving, compared to conventional frozen meals which can exceed 1,000-1,500mg. This is important for those managing blood pressure, heart disease, or kidney conditions.

When selecting low-sodium options, be prepared for less intense flavors initially. Enhance these meals with sodium-free seasonings like fresh herbs, lemon juice, vinegar, garlic, or salt-free spice blends. Your taste preferences will adapt over time, and you'll begin appreciating the natural flavors of the ingredients rather than relying on salt for taste.

No Added Sugar Products

No added sugar frozen meals contain no refined sugars, syrups, or artificial sweeteners added during manufacturing. Any sweetness comes from naturally occurring sugars in vegetables, fruits, or dairy products included in the recipe.

This is particularly important for those managing diabetes, following low-carb diets, or simply trying to reduce sugar intake. Check the nutrition label for "total sugars" versus "added sugars"—the latter should be zero or very low in these products.

Organic Certifications

Organic frozen meals use ingredients grown without synthetic pesticides, herbicides, or fertilizers, and without genetically modified organisms (GMOs). Organic animal products come from animals raised without antibiotics or growth hormones.

The USDA Organic certification requires that 95% or more of ingredients be certified organic. "Made with organic ingredients" means at least 70% organic content. While organic doesn't automatically mean healthier in terms of macronutrients, many consumers prefer organic for environmental reasons or to minimize pesticide exposure.

Non-GMO Verification

Non-GMO products contain no genetically modified organisms. The Non-GMO Project Verified seal indicates independent verification that ingredients haven't been genetically engineered. This is particularly relevant for corn, soy, canola, and sugar beet ingredients, which are commonly genetically modified in conventional agriculture.

For those concerned about GMOs, look for both Non-GMO Project Verified seals and organic certifications, as organic standards prohibit GMOs by definition.

Understanding Certifications

Multiple third-party certifications provide assurance that frozen meals meet specific standards:

USDA Organic: Verifies organic farming practices and prohibits GMOs, synthetic pesticides, and artificial ingredients.

Non-GMO Project Verified: Confirms no genetically modified ingredients through rigorous testing and ongoing verification.

Certified Gluten-Free: Ensures products contain less than 20 parts per million of gluten, the threshold considered safe for most people with celiac disease.

Certified Vegan: Verifies no animal products or by-products were used in ingredients or processing.

Heart-Check Certification: From the American Heart Association, indicates meals meet specific criteria for heart-healthy nutrition including limits on saturated fat, trans fat, and sodium.

These certifications provide confidence that meals meet your dietary requirements without requiring you to scrutinize every ingredient.

Packaging, Sustainability, and Consumer Information

Modern frozen meal packaging serves multiple functions beyond simple containment—it provides critical safety information, facilitates proper heating, and increasingly addresses environmental concerns.

Packaging Materials and Sustainability

Contemporary frozen meals use various packaging materials, each with specific advantages. Most common are plastic trays made from CPET (crystallized polyethylene terephthalate), which withstands both freezing and heating temperatures. These trays are often microwave-safe and oven-safe up to specific temperatures.

Increasingly, manufacturers are adopting recyclable packaging to reduce environmental impact. Check your local recycling guidelines, as not all plastic types are accepted in all municipalities. Some brands now use compostable packaging materials made from plant-based sources, though these typically require commercial composting facilities rather than home composting.

The outer cardboard sleeves that protect frozen meals are typically recyclable through standard paper recycling. Remove any plastic film windows before recycling. Some brands print recycling instructions directly on the packaging to guide proper disposal.

Microwave-Safe Packaging Features

Microwave-safe packaging is specifically engineered to withstand microwave heating without melting, warping, or leaching chemicals into food. Look for the microwave-safe symbol (usually a series of wavy lines) on the packaging.

These packages often include built-in venting systems—small perforations or lift-tab corners that allow steam to escape during heating. This prevents pressure buildup that could cause the package to burst while simultaneously preventing the soggy texture that results from trapped steam condensation.

Some advanced packaging includes dual-compartment designs that allow different components to heat at different rates. For example, a section containing sauce might have thinner walls for faster heating, while a section containing rice has thicker insulation for more gradual warming.

Clear Allergen and Cross-Contact Information

Responsible manufacturers provide comprehensive allergen information that goes beyond simply listing ingredients. Look for dedicated allergen statements that explicitly identify the presence of the eight major allergens: milk, eggs, fish, shellfish, tree nuts, peanuts, wheat, and soybeans.

Clear allergen cross-contact warnings inform consumers when a product is manufactured in facilities that also process allergens, even if those allergens aren't ingredients in the specific product. This is crucial for individuals with severe allergies who may react to trace amounts. Statements like "Made in a facility that also processes tree nuts" or "May contain traces of wheat" provide this essential information.

The most responsible brands use dedicated production lines for allergen-free products, minimizing cross-contamination risk. Some facilities undergo third-party allergen testing and certification to verify their allergen control procedures.

Dietary Claims Clarity

Packaging should clearly communicate dietary attributes through both text and recognizable symbols. "Vegan," "Gluten-Free," "Dairy-Free," and similar claims should be prominently displayed on the front of package for easy identification while shopping.

The nutrition facts panel provides detailed information including calories per meal, protein per meal, total carbohydrates, fiber, sugars, fat, and micronutrients. This transparency allows consumers to make informed decisions aligned with their nutritional goals.

Serving size information should be clearly stated. Some packages contain multiple servings, which can be confusing if you assume the entire package represents one meal. Always verify the "servings per container" line to understand whether nutritional information represents the entire package or a portion of it.

Origin and Ingredient Traceability

Increasingly, consumers want to know where their food comes from and how it was produced. Progressive brands provide ingredient sourcing information, identifying the origin of key ingredients or highlighting partnerships with specific farms or suppliers.

Traceability systems allow manufacturers to track ingredients from farm to final product, ensuring quality control and enabling rapid response if safety issues arise. Some brands provide QR codes on packaging that link to detailed sourcing information, allowing consumers to learn about the specific farms that grew their vegetables or raised their proteins.

Country of origin labeling for meat products is required in the United States, informing consumers where animals were born, raised, and processed. Similar transparency for other ingredients, while not always required, demonstrates a brand's commitment to quality and consumer trust.

Appliance-Specific Heating Guidance

The most helpful packaging provides detailed heating instructions for multiple appliances, recognizing that consumers have different equipment and preferences. Look for instructions covering:

Microwave heating: Wattage-specific timing (typically providing instructions for 1100-watt and lower-wattage units separately), whether to cover or vent, and whether stirring is recommended.

Conventional oven: Temperature, whether to remove from packaging, approximate heating time, and any preparation steps like covering with foil.

Air fryer: Temperature settings, time ranges, and any special considerations like transferring to air fryer-safe containers.

Stovetop: For meals that can be heated in a pan, instructions should include heat level, whether to add liquid, and approximate timing.

This appliance-specific heating guidance respects that different methods produce different results and allows consumers to choose based on their available time and desired outcome.

Safety, Quality, and Troubleshooting

Understanding food safety principles and troubleshooting common issues ensures consistently safe, delicious results.

Food Safety Fundamentals

The single-reheat warning on frozen prepared meals exists for important safety reasons. Each heating cycle creates opportunities for bacterial growth if food spends time in the "danger zone" (40-140°F/4-60°C). Reheating multiple times increases this risk exponentially.

Always heat frozen meals to an internal temperature of 165°F (74°C) throughout. Use a food thermometer to verify, inserting it into the thickest part of the meal. Visual cues (steam, bubbling) aren't reliable indicators of safe temperature.

Never let heated meals sit at room temperature for more than two hours (one hour if room temperature exceeds 90°F). If you're not ready to eat immediately after heating, refrigerate promptly and reheat once more when ready, understanding this violates the single-reheat guideline and should be done only occasionally.

Texture Troubleshooting

Soggy vegetables: This typically results from trapped steam. Ensure proper venting during heating. For air fryer preparation, avoid overcrowding and don't cover the food.

Dry proteins: Usually caused by overheating. Reduce heating time by 30-second intervals and check frequently. For microwave heating, cover proteins with a damp paper towel to maintain moisture.

Rubbery texture: Overheating is the primary culprit. This is particularly common with seafood and chicken. Use lower power settings for longer periods rather than high power for short bursts.

Uneven heating: Insufficient stirring or rotation causes this. Pause heating at the halfway point, stir thoroughly, and redistribute components. For microwave heating, rotate the container 180 degrees if your microwave doesn't have a turntable.

Separated sauces: Rapid heating causes emulsions to break. Heat sauces at reduced power (50-70%) and stir frequently. After heating, whisk vigorously to re-emulsify.

Storage Problem Prevention

Freezer burn: Appears as grayish-white dry spots on food surface. Prevent by ensuring airtight packaging and stable freezer temperatures. Once freezer burn occurs, affected areas have diminished quality but remain safe to eat.

Ice crystal formation: Large ice crystals indicate thawing and refreezing. This compromises texture significantly. Maintain stable freezer temperatures and avoid storing meals in freezer doors where temperature fluctuates.

Packaging damage: Torn or punctured packaging allows air exposure that degrades quality. Inspect packages before purchasing and handle carefully during storage. Transfer damaged packages to airtight containers immediately.

Timing Optimization

Perfecting heating times requires understanding your specific appliances. Microwave wattage varies significantly—a 700-watt microwave requires nearly twice the heating time of a 1200-watt unit. Check your microwave's wattage (usually listed inside the door or in the manual) and adjust package instructions accordingly.

For air fryers, basket size and air circulation patterns affect heating efficiency. Smaller air fryers with powerful fans heat more quickly than larger models. Start with package recommendations and adjust based on your results, keeping detailed notes for future reference.

Create a personal heating guide for your most frequently purchased meals, noting exact times and power settings that produce optimal results with your specific equipment. This eliminates guesswork and ensures consistency.
